What is a VPS and How Does It Work?

A Virtual Private Server (VPS) is a virtualized server that mimics a dedicated server within a larger physical server. The physical server is divided into multiple virtual servers that operate independently. Each VPS has its own operating system and resources, which means that traders can install trading software applications and run them 24/7 without interruptions. When you trade on a VPS, all actions are executed from a remote location, reducing latency and enhancing the overall performance of your trading strategies.

Why Use a VPS for Forex Trading?

Opting for a VPS comes with numerous advantages that can significantly improve trading performance:

  • Low Latency: A VPS can improve trade execution time, as many providers offer servers located near liquidity providers. This reduces the time it takes for orders to reach the market, which is critical in forex trading.
  • Improved Reliability: A VPS reduces the risk of internet connection drops, power outages, and hardware failures, ensuring that your trading activities remain uninterrupted.
  • 24/7 Operation: With a VPS, your trading algorithms can run continuously. This is particularly beneficial for automated trading systems that capitalize on market movements at all hours.
  • Enhanced Security: VPS providers usually offer robust security measures, including firewalls and backup solutions, protecting your trading data and strategies.

Choosing the Right VPS for Forex Trading

When selecting a VPS for forex trading, it’s essential to consider various factors to ensure it meets your trading needs:

  • Server Location: Choose a VPS with servers located near the trading servers of your broker to minimize latency.
  • Performance: Look for VPS with ample RAM, CPU cores, and bandwidth to support your trading operations effectively.
  • Technical Support: Ensure that the VPS provider offers reliable customer support to assist you in case of technical issues.
  • Price: Compare the pricing plans of different providers while ensuring that you do not compromise on performance and reliability.

Setting Up Your VPS for Forex Trading

Once you’ve selected a VPS provider, the next step is setting it up for forex trading:

  1. Choose Your Operating System: Most VPS providers offer a selection between Windows and Linux. For forex trading, Windows is often preferred due to compatibility with popular trading platforms like MetaTrader 4/5.
  2. Install Trading Software: After setting up the operating system, download and install the trading platforms you plan to use. Ensure everything runs smoothly during setup.
  3. Configure Security Settings: Set up your firewall and consider using a VPN for additional security. This will help protect sensitive trading information.
  4. Test Your Configuration: Before fully relying on your VPS, run tests to ensure that trades execute as expected without any hitches.

Common VPS Problems and Solutions

While VPS providers strive to maintain performance, problems can occasionally arise. Here are some common issues and their solutions:

  • Slow Performance: If your VPS is running slowly, consider upgrading your plan or optimizing your trading strategies and software to use fewer resources.
  • Downtime: Regularly check your server’s uptime status. If there are frequent outages, contact customer support to resolve the issue or consider switching providers.
  • Security Breaches: Always ensure that your VPS is running the latest security patches and consider implementing additional measures, such as stronger passwords and two-factor authentication.
